A Milton Keynes actress/businesswoman has been chosen to represent England in the Mrs World beauty pageant in South Africa in December.
Ex Brookside TV star Ann Marie Davies – who is married to former MK Dons manager Karl Robinson – has been selected by the director of Mrs World to compete at the prestigious event in Johannesburg.
And Ann, who owns The Dress Empire shop in Fenny Stratford, is excited about the competition ahead after The Tanning Shop stepped in to sponsor her.
Ann said: “I am delighted to have this opportunity and I cannot thank my sponsor The Tanning Shop enough, whose kind sponsorship has made this happen.
“It is a dream come true and I’m overwhelmed by the support that this company has given me and honoured to be their brand ambassador here in Milton Keynes.
“We will be working closely over the next few months and I’m hoping to bring the title of Mrs World back to MK.”
Ann is no stranger to beauty pageants, having represented the UK in Mrs Universe and won Mrs British Empire, Miss Merseyside, Miss Manchester and Miss Wirral Globe before moving down from Liverpool with Karl, who is now manager of Charlton Athletic.
